Letters PatentNe. 107,615, lated September '20, 1870.
IMPROVEMENT-'IN `:DEVICES FOR MOVING. BUILDINGS.
The Schedule referred to in these Letters Patent and making part of the same To all whom it may concern .-A
Be it known that I; STEPHEN INMAN, of Rockford,`. lin the county of Winnebago and State of Illinois, have invented a new and improved Device for Moving Buildings; and I do hereby declare that the following is`a full and exact description of the same, reference being vhad to the accompanying drawing and to the letters of reference marked thereon.
This invention relates yto devices for moving buildings or other heavy articles on 'common roads, and consists in an improved constructiouand arrangement for rollers and frames, as will ybe hereinafter more fully set forth. Y,
vIn the drawingand Figure 2, a side elevation.
'A is a large frame, and may representthe building or otherlarge body 'to he moved,to which each of the trucks is temporarily attached.
The. trucks themselves have double rollers, a a, ou one shaft oi"axle,v\\"hich axles have their bearings in vertical standards, b b, made suflicientl y strong, as are the axles and'rollers, to endure greatweight.
These standards are shouldered above, and those of eachaxle are connected by transverse bars, c c, as shown in iig. 1.
When the truck is ycomposed of two pairs of wheels, the -pairs arefurther connected by longitudinal bars, d d, with open slotted ends, embracing the transverse bars, and having the standards passing through them, the whole beingconstructed and the parts adapted to each other in such a manner that the rollers may he ,turned in different directions without detachiug the trucks from thc building or frame which rests upon them.
Thus, the longitudinal hars al (l, renia'iningvin the same direction, the transversebars c c may be swung, turning the rollers in other directions, and changing the form of the frame from rectangular to rholnbic plan. f
It will be further observcdthat the bearings are upon the centers of the hars or holsters ce. These may beformed with broad hearing plates, with circular grooves therein for spherical ii'ictiou-rollers, there being a corresponding plate resting upon and rconn` ing the rollers in place.v
'lhese 'upper'.plates are attached to alongitudinal bar, e, which is to he attached to the building or other structure to bc moved. These friction-rollers, it is evident, are easily kept in place by suitable attachments, as a center bolt, or by the weight of the building, and permit the trucks, even when heavilyloaded,
Figure lrepresentsnl plan oiithe device reversed,
toitu'rn easily. The transverse barsor holsters swing*-L nnder the har e with a. motion limited `only bythe con?? tactot' the standards with the bar.
If the bars e of the severalvtrucks are all longitu. dinally arranged, as these are shown in fig. 1, by swingi ing\ the holsters, they may be turned to the right or l it,
aud-the building deflected from v the straight line to considerable extent. If, however, itfbe desired tur move sometimes at right anglesto the rst liuc of motion, the trucks may beset diagonally, as shown in- Then the trucks may be swung parallel to the forward end, x, of the frame of build one truckin iig. 1.
ing,'move forward o`r\parallel to the.. side y, and move Sidewise. v y l f l,
A connecting-bar is provided,'adjustable in length, shown ath, iig. 1, which holds the rollers in any de: sircd position." v l It will'be evident Vthat the side bars and transverse bolster may be attached in any suitable manner, it be- Y ing only provided that the holsters may have swing ing inotionfas described.- I have shown thesidebars madeot' open bars of metal, but any other convenient' construction may he lused without departing from the. spirit of 'my invention. v g At the ends of the side bars I have arranged loops, f f, into which levers may be placed, for fthe purpose of turning-,the trucks iu any direction desired.
l'The cross-bars should he made rounding ou their upper sides, to allow the parts to adapt themselves tol rounded for thcuneven ground, and the rollers are same purpose.
Itis' evident, in the use ot these trucks, that the weight-is equalized, and if one roller drops into a hole the weight will he taken up by the others, and the building kept from strain.
This apparat-us may be conveniently taken apart' for transportation. y
Having thus fully described my' invention,
. That I claim as new, and desire to secure by Letters Patent of the United States, is-
1. truck for moving heavy structures, having double rollers a. (t on each axle, and center bearings above each pair, the two pairs being so connected as to swing together in any desired direction.
2. The adj ustahlebar h, constructed and applied to the truck, asset forth.
